Job Description
Analyzes customer information requirements and product specifications to define technical content strategy and plan.
Designs and develops written and/or visual product-related information (hard copy, web guides, user/deployment/configuration/troubleshooting guides, and online information such as interactive demos and help systems) integrated into product for a variety of audiences (end user, build and deployment engineers, system administrators, internal support engineers, product developers, training developers).
Codes, builds, compiles, and tests online information and/or sets up, loads and tests system hardware to create information deliverables and provide feedback on ease of use and user interfaces to product development.
Acts as a customer advocate to help define/refine product requirements.
Develops standards, style documents and templates, scripts, style sheets, and graphical libraries to ensure a common look and feel.
Interfaces with cross-functional areas as a member of the product or service development and delivery team, such as service delivery, marketing, test, support, and manufacturing.
Education and Experience Required
Typically a First-Level University degree in Technical Communications, Computer Science or related technical/communications field and a minimum of 6+ years related experience, or an Advanced University degree and a minimum of 4-6 years experience, or equivalent.
Knowledge of, and ability to utilize, a variety of tools and technologies to support multiple technologies.
Knowledge and Skills
Knowledge expert for multiple products within a technology.
Creates information strategy for a technology.
Familiar with DITA, HTML, DHTML, XML, JavaScript or similar as required.
May provide help systems that are integrated with software products that use proprietary coding methods.
